kroppheather/synthesis_database: Permafrost soil and vegetation temperature database and statistical analysis

Code for a database that stores soil temperature and vegetation data across the permafrost regions. Code also contains a statistical model for organizing data and filling in missing soil or air temperature data using a Bayesian statistical analysis (Temp_model folder).
